Solution

Correct Answer:

It will continue in uniform motion

  1. Newton's First Law: States that every body continues in its state of rest or of uniform motion in a straight line unless it is compelled by some external force to change that state.
  2. Analysis:
    • The surface is frictionless, so there is no resistive force.
    • No other external forces are applied.
  3. Result: The net force .
  4. Conclusion: According to the Law of Inertia, the block will maintain its current velocity (uniform motion) forever.
